About The Position

Responsible for managing Third-Party Payor contracting activities within all market segments for McLaren Physician Partners (MPP), McLaren Health Care Corporation (MHCC), McLaren High Performance Network (MHPN) and its subsidiaries. Working with leadership, conducts complex contract modeling and analysis with an understanding of population health and value-based contracting. Professionally and effectively communicates the advantages of contracting with McLaren, provides ongoing expertise throughout the contracting process and administration of payor agreements. Key team resource to the contract management team.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for managing contracting activities, including but not limited to review, redline, and evaluation of language, and execution of the Managed Care contracts.
  • Manages the contracting staff regarding contracting processes, workflows, and direction. Acts as a SME for all contracting activities of MPP, MHCC, MHPN and its subsidiaries, including providing ad hoc assistance and support as requested.
  • Responsible for review and resolution of billing, utilization review and administrative issues with Third Party Payors.
  • Analyzes changes in payer policies, rules and regulations impacting both facility and physician payments. Communicates and educates those impacted, as necessary. Makes recommendations to maintain regulatory compliance and internal controls as required.
  • Participates in and may lead during negotiations. Identifies any issues and coordinates contract workflow/approval through to contract execution and administration of contracts.
  • Motivates staff; defines priorities and communicates to staff organizational goals and works with them to achieve them; seeks commitment from staff, encourages innovation and team building/planning.
